<p>Cologix is seeking a motivated Senior Director to lead our ongoing initiatives related to the critical infrastructure development of new and existing data centers. The candidate should have strong supply chain and technical procurement skills, analytical and financial acumen, communication capabilities and a hands-on passion to dive-deep into processes used in our data center operations business. Additionally, candidates must have proven skills in managing large-scale supply chain and procurement improvement projects.</p> <p>The Senior Director, Critical Infrastructure Sourcing and Procurement will create and implement sourcing strategies within the Construction and Data Center Operations business and will collaborate with internal business partners and suppliers to drive efficiencies, minimize risks and reduce costs for Cologix. The successful candidate will develop metrics to hold suppliers accountable for performance and delivery and will drive results via competitive bidding, negotiating, and successful analysis of data and market trends.</p> <p>The candidate thinks long term, drives multiple initiatives, communicates effectively and influences customers and suppliers at all levels. In addition, this individual will be highly analytical; think strategically; exhibit curiosity and a drive for continuous learning; have a sense of urgency within a deadline driven environment and have a high level of customer focus and business acumen.</p> <p>Key Responsibilities:</p> <ul> <li>Oversee the end-to-end supply chain process for critical infrastructure projects, ensuring timely procurement and delivery of materials and equipment. </li><li>Work closely with engineering, operations, construction and delivery teams to identify key supply risks impacting on-time data center delivery and implement proactive mechanisms to mitigate risks. </li><li>Develop and manage procurement strategies for technical components, negotiating with vendors to secure the best terms and total cost of ownership. </li><li>Lead the development of long-term supply agreements to mitigate capacity and delivery risks, drive cost savings, enable faster DC delivery, and embodied carbon reduction. </li><li>Establish and maintain strong relationships with suppliers and contractors, monitoring performance and ensuring compliance with contractual agreements. </li><li>Lead infrastructure development projects from inception to completion, ensuring alignment with company goals and timelines. </li><li>Prepare and present project status reports to senior management, highlighting key milestones, risks, and mitigation strategies. </li><li>Identify opportunities for process improvements in supply chain and logistics operations, implementing best practices to enhance efficiency and effectiveness. </li></ul> <p>Qualifications:</p> <ul> <li>Bachelor's degree in supply chain management, Engineering, Project Management, or a related field. A master's degree is preferred. </li><li>Minimum of 8+ years of experience in supply chain management, technical procurement, and logistics, preferably in the infrastructure or data center industry. </li><li>8+ years of experience supporting strategic sourcing, including vendor negotiations, contract management, process improvement and operational analysis. </li><li>PMP, CSCP, or equivalent certification is highly desirable. </li><li>Proficiency in supply chain management software and tools. </li><li>Strong knowledge set around MEP. </li><li>An ability to interpret relevant AHJ codes/regulations that might influence procurement decisions. </li><li>Ability to read mechanical one lines or electrical SLD's is highly desirable. </li><li>Proven ability to influence and motivate cross-functional teams, with excellent interpersonal and communication skills. </li><li>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ities, with keen attention to detail. </li><li>In-depth understanding of supply chain and logistics operations, including regulatory and compliance requirements. </li><li>Applicants must be authorized to work for any employer in the U.S. We are unable to sponsor or transfer sponsorship of an employment visa at this time, including CPT/OPT.* </li></ul>
